What Is XPEL ARMOR Textured PPF?
XPEL ARMOR is a specialized paint protection film within the XPEL product family that is purpose-built for vehicles that face demanding conditions. While the XPEL Ultimate Plus delivers optically clear, invisible protection and the XPEL Stealth transforms gloss paint into a matte satin finish, XPEL ARMOR takes a completely different approach. It features a distinctive textured surface that gives your vehicle a tactical, aggressive appearance while simultaneously protecting the underlying paint from rock chips, road debris, branch scratches, gravel impacts, and environmental contaminants.
XPEL ARMOR is not designed to disappear — it is designed to make a statement. XPEL ARMOR Key Features and Technical Specifications
XPEL ARMOR shares the core protective technology that has made the XPEL paint protection film lineup the most trusted in the industry, but it adds a unique textured topcoat that sets it apart from every other PPF on the market. Here are the key features and technical specifications that make XPEL ARMOR stand out:
Textured Finish: The defining characteristic of XPEL ARMOR is its textured surface. Unlike the gloss-clear finish of XPEL Ultimate Plus or the satin-matte finish of XPEL Stealth, ARMOR has a tactile, grainy texture that gives the protected surface a rugged, industrial look. This texture also serves a practical purpose — it is better at hiding minor imperfections, scratches, and blemishes that would be visible on a smooth, clear film. For vehicles that see heavy use on trails, job sites, or in urban environments where door dings and parking lot damage are inevitable, the textured finish is a significant advantage.
Self-Healing Technology: Like all XPEL paint protection films, ARMOR features XPEL's proprietary self-healing topcoat technology. When the film sustains minor scratches or swirl marks, heat from the sun, warm water, or a heat gun activates the self-healing process, causing the scratches to disappear and the film to return to its original textured finish. This is critical for off-road vehicles that regularly encounter branches, brush, and debris on the trail — the film heals itself so you do not have to worry about accumulated damage over time.
UV and Stain Resistance: XPEL ARMOR is formulated with advanced UV stabilizers that prevent the film from yellowing, fading, or degrading over time. This is especially important in Los Angeles, where vehicles are exposed to intense UV radiation year-round. The film also resists staining from tree sap, bird droppings, insect splatter, mud, and road tar — all common hazards for trucks and SUVs driven both on and off road in the greater Los Angeles area.
Impact Protection: XPEL ARMOR provides robust protection against rock chips, gravel impacts, and road debris. The film absorbs the energy from impacts that would otherwise chip, scratch, or gouge your vehicle's paint. For truck owners who regularly haul materials, tow trailers, or drive on unpaved roads in the Angeles National Forest, the San Gabriel Mountains, or the Mojave Desert, this level of impact protection is essential.

XPEL ARMOR vs. XPEL Ultimate Plus vs. XPEL Stealth: Which PPF Is Right for Your Vehicle?
XPEL offers several PPF products, and choosing the right one depends on your vehicle type, driving conditions, and aesthetic preferences. Here is a detailed comparison of the three primary XPEL PPF products to help you decide which one is the best fit:
XPEL Ultimate Plus is the flagship clear PPF product. It is an 8-mil thick, optically clear film with self-healing technology and a high-gloss finish that is virtually invisible once installed. Ultimate Plus is ideal for luxury cars, sports cars, and daily drivers where the goal is to protect the original paint without altering the vehicle's appearance. It is the most popular PPF product at Rapid Window Tinting and the top choice for BMW, Mercedes-Benz, Porsche, and Tesla owners in Los Angeles who want invisible protection.
XPEL Stealth is the matte and satin finish PPF. It transforms any gloss paint into a flat matte or satin finish while providing the same self-healing protection as Ultimate Plus. Stealth is popular among car enthusiasts who want to achieve a factory-matte look without actually repainting their vehicle. It is especially popular on dark-colored vehicles like matte black Teslas, matte gray Porsches, and satin-wrapped BMWs. Stealth also protects vehicles that already have a factory matte paint finish.
XPEL ARMOR is the textured, heavy-duty PPF. It is designed specifically for trucks, SUVs, and off-road vehicles that need rugged protection and a bold aesthetic. The textured finish sets it apart from both Ultimate Plus and Stealth, giving it a tactical look that complements aggressive vehicle styling. ARMOR is the best choice for Ford F-150 Raptor, Jeep Wrangler, Toyota Tacoma TRD, Ford Bronco, Tesla Cybertruck, and other vehicles that are built for adventure. It hides imperfections better than clear or matte films, making it the most forgiving option for vehicles that see heavy daily use.
The choice between these three products ultimately comes down to your priorities. If you want invisible protection, choose Ultimate Plus. If you want a matte finish, choose Stealth. If you want a rugged, textured look with heavy-duty protection for a truck or SUV, choose ARMOR. XPEL ARMOR Installation Process at Rapid Window Tinting Los Angeles
Installing XPEL ARMOR requires the same level of skill, precision, and attention to detail as any premium PPF installation. At Rapid Window Tinting, our XPEL certified installation team follows a meticulous multi-step process to ensure your ARMOR installation looks perfect and performs flawlessly for years:
Step 1 — Vehicle Assessment and Consultation: We start by thoroughly inspecting your vehicle's paint condition and discussing your coverage goals. For most truck and SUV owners, we recommend protecting the high-impact zones first: front bumper, hood, fenders, rocker panels, door edges, mirror caps, and A-pillars. Full-body ARMOR coverage is also available for maximum protection and a consistent textured appearance across the entire vehicle.
Step 2 — Paint Decontamination and Preparation: Before any film is applied, we perform a thorough wash and decontamination of the vehicle's paint surface. This includes a clay bar treatment to remove embedded contaminants, iron decontamination to dissolve ferrous particles, and an isopropyl alcohol wipe-down to ensure the surface is perfectly clean and free of any residue that could interfere with the film's adhesion.
Step 3 — Precision Template Cutting with XPEL DAP: We use XPEL's Design Access Program (DAP) software to cut film templates that are engineered to fit your exact vehicle make, model, and year. DAP templates eliminate the need for hand-trimming on the vehicle, which reduces the risk of blade marks on your paint and ensures consistent, repeatable results. XPEL maintains the largest database of vehicle-specific templates in the PPF industry, with thousands of patterns covering trucks, SUVs, sedans, and sports cars.
Step 4 — Film Application in a Controlled Environment: ARMOR is applied in our climate-controlled installation bay using a wet application method that allows our installers to position and adjust the film before it bonds to the paint. The film is carefully stretched and tucked around edges, contours, and compound curves to ensure complete coverage with no visible edges or lifting points. Our installation environment is filtered to minimize dust and debris that could become trapped under the film.
Step 5 — Final Inspection and Curing: After installation, we perform a comprehensive final inspection under multiple light sources to verify perfect alignment, edge sealing, and surface consistency. The film requires a curing period of approximately 24 to 48 hours to fully bond to the paint, during which time you should avoid washing the vehicle or exposing it to heavy rain. After curing, ARMOR is fully bonded and ready for whatever roads, trails, or conditions you throw at it.

XPEL ARMOR Maintenance and Care Tips
One of the great advantages of XPEL ARMOR is that it requires minimal maintenance compared to unprotected paint. The textured surface is naturally resistant to showing minor scratches and water spots, and the self-healing technology takes care of superficial marks automatically. However, there are some best practices to keep your ARMOR installation looking its best for the full lifespan of the product:
Washing your vehicle regularly is the most important maintenance step. Use a pH-neutral car wash soap and a soft microfiber wash mitt to gently clean the film surface. Avoid automatic car washes with stiff brushes, as these can be more aggressive than necessary on any PPF product. A touchless automatic car wash is acceptable, but hand washing is always preferred for PPF-protected vehicles.
Avoid using abrasive polishes or compounds on the ARMOR surface. The textured finish is intentional, and buffing the film with an aggressive polish could alter the texture. If you notice stubborn contaminants like tree sap or bird droppings on the film, use an isopropyl alcohol solution or a PPF-safe detail spray to dissolve the contaminant gently.
Ceramic coating can be applied over XPEL ARMOR to add an additional layer of hydrophobic protection. This combination makes the textured surface even easier to clean and adds extra UV resistance.
